什么是外键? (What is a foreign key?)

In the previous section, we concluded that there is some kind of relationship between our two tables. The attribute from one table (city.country_id) is related to the primary key attribute from another table (country.id). That attribute (city.country_id) is a FK attribute. The table country is the referenced table, and the table city is the child table. This relationship actually says that value stored in the city.country_id attribute should be one from the set of values stored in the country.id attribute (or, in some cases, although not this one, could be undefined = NULL).

So, the definition of the FK would be:

因此,FK的定义为:

“The foreign key is an attribute, or more of them, directly related to the primary key of another table. When properly set, this rule shall ensure that we must always set the value of that attribute to exactly 1 value from the referenced table. This is the way how we relate data stored in different tables in our database model.”

You can see the following settings:

您可以看到以下设置:

  • Enforce for replication – possible values here are “Yes” and “No” – Enables or disables it for replication. Please read more about the replication in SQL Server Replication (Merge) – What gets replicated and what doesn’t article

FK will do a few checks, but most important are:

FK将进行一些检查,但最重要的是:

  • If you add a row to a table, the attribute which is part of the foreign key must have the pair in the original table (1:n). It can be NULL if the type of that relation (FK) is not mandatory (0:n). In any case, it can’t contain a value not existing in the referenced table

    In our case, this means, that we can’t add a city if the country_id is not in the range [1,5] – set of id values from the country table. If we try to execute something like this (notice that in this statement country_id = 6 and we don’t have a pair in the country table):

    INSERT INTO city (city_name, lat, long, country_id) VALUES ('Wien', 48.2084885, 16.3720798, 6);
    

    This is what happens:

    And this is great because the FK prevented us from making a mistake

    Note: In case we could execute this INSERT statement, we would insert a city belonging to a country with id = 6, without actually knowing that country. Later, someone could insert e.g. the Netherlands as the country with id = 6 and we would have inconsistent data

  • When we delete data from the referenced table, we won’t be able to delete if there are related records in the child table. This stands when setting Delete Rule is set to “No Action” (this should be how you set your foreign key in most cases). “Cascade” would also delete rows from the child table, while “Set NULL” and “Set Default” wouldn’t delete entire rows from the child table, but just set the values of these attributes to NULL or predefined value

    Let’s try to delete country with id = 5 (Poland) using the statement:

    DELETE FROM country WHERE id = 5;
    

    The result is shown below:

    Once again, this is really great because the defined rule (FK), prevented us from deleting something we still use

    Note: If the statement would delete Poland, then Warsaw would be assigned to the non-existing country. While we don’t know which country it belongs to, someone could later insert another country with id = 5 (as for inserts) and we would have a problem with our data.

The FK, when defined properly, instead of you, does the job in the background. It takes care of the referential integrity in our database.
